How weight reduction happens

The otherworldly mystery to getting more fit appears to change with anything prevailing fashion diet is moving, however actually, physiologically, there's just a single method for making it happen. (Saying this doesn't imply that different variables can't obstruct, yet we'll get to those later.)

"Weight reduction happens when there is a supported calorie shortage, driving the body to use put away fat for energy," makes sense of Gem Scott, R.D., an enlisted dietician with Top Sustenance Training. "This regularly occurs through a blend of decreased calorie consumption and expanded active work."

At the end of the day, weight reduction happens when you eat less calories than you consume and the body goes to fat stores for fuel. The more you resolve, the additional consuming happens and the more probable weight reduction becomes.

Weight reduction and contributing elements

Albeit the logical recipe for weight reduction is straightforward, we, as individual people, are not. Bunches of variables assume a colossal part all the while, as:

Hereditary qualities/Genetics/

"Every individual's hereditary cosmetics can impact how their body answers diet and exercise, affecting weight reduction," says Scott. This peculiarity is broadly considered-research shows hereditary qualities and an individual's helplessness to weight gain are connected.

Beginning weight

The higher your underlying weight, the more probable you are to get in shape quicker. "Fundamentally, the more you gauge, the more energy your body needs to work," makes sense of Megan Hilbert, R.D., enlisted dietitian with Top Sustenance Instructing, so the energy consumption (caloric consume) will be higher to begin. Nonetheless, "as weight reduction advances, the pace of misfortune will in general stoppage for everybody," Scott adds.

Hormones

"Hormonal irregular characteristics or conditions, for example, thyroid problems can influence weight reduction progress," makes sense of Scott. Different circumstances, including polycystic ovarian condition, Cushing's sickness, menopause, and low testosterone, may cause variances in weight, as per the Public Library of Medication.

Age

Research shows that grown-ups north of 70 can have 20 to 25% lower resting metabolic rates (the quantity of calories the body consumes very still), making it more hard to get thinner with age.

Generally wellbeing and way of life

Scott makes sense of that ailments and actual capacity can influence an individual's weight reduction, as can rest cleanliness and general active work.

Dangers of getting more fit excessively fast

Dropping excessively far into calorie limitation can cause a huge number of medical problems, including supplement lacks, peevishness, weariness, and stoppage, says Hilbert. "It's critical to meet your body's base day to day necessities thus," she adds. The general everyday suggested calorie admission is anyplace somewhere in the range of 1,600 and 2,400 calories, contingent upon age and action level, per the US Branch of Farming. Be that as it may, an enlisted dietitian can assist you with figuring out your perfect balance.

Opposite symptoms of quick weight reduction, as indicated by Scott, include:

Muscle misfortune: Quick weight reduction can prompt muscle misfortune, which may adversely affect digestion and body structure.

Gallstones: Fast weight reduction can keep the gallbladder from discharging appropriately, expanding the gamble of creating gallstones.

Electrolyte lopsided characteristics: This can cause unfavorable consequences for the body.

Mental effects: Incredibly prohibitive weight control plans can prompt sensations of hardship, cluttered eating designs, and a negative relationship with food.

Anyway, how long does it require to shed pounds?

In the event that you follow a calorie shortfall, Scott says you can by and large hope to see starting weight reduction inside half a month. Hilbert adds that some might see changes in as little as seven days.

"Meaning to get in shape at a pace of 0.5 to 1 lb each week is by and large viewed as a protected and manageable objective," says Scott. "Progressive weight reduction considers better protection of bulk, adherence to sound propensities, and long haul achievement."

It's essential to note, in any case, that weight changes are typical. "Progress is frequently not absolutely direct, so remember that half a month you might lose more, different weeks you might be on a level, and this is all important for the interaction," says Hilbert. "Weight reduction is a drawn out game."

For ideal, sound outcomes, alongside a suitable activity routine, Scott prescribes counseling an enrolled dietitian to foster an individualized weight reduction plan.
